  2. No, it's not waiting on the tag manager, it's trying to throttle adding nodes to the ISY so it doesn't overwhelm it. But the udi_interface (the module between the NS and PG3) is multithreaded and not all python list functions are thread safe, so the code gets confused. I need to figure out how to make the code thread safe, or use a Python mutex.

  18. @mbking If you shutdown the PG2 NS and install on PG3 it should just work. The NS only has one identifier so Harmony doesn't care that it moved to a different IP address, it will automatically be seen. Just make sure to change the default port number when you install on PG3 along with setting the other params, then restart. All the same devices will be available since that info is contained on the ISY. However, if you don't copy the config file as mentioned in the doc then the ID's may change so you may have to edit the buttons in the Harmony app. If you leave the PG2 NS in place it will automatically startup if/when PG2 is restarted which will create a conflict, so best to delete it from PG2.
